Analysis

Late-demographic dividend recorded 8.61 million for secondary education, teachers, female in 2024. That is the highest value across all 47 years on record.

The figure is up 2.5% on the previous year and up 25.2% over ten years.

Over the whole period, secondary education, teachers, female in Late-demographic dividend peaked at 8.61 million in 2024 and was at its lowest, 3.77 million, in 1978.

That places Late-demographic dividend 8th out of 45 groups with data for 2024, putting it in the top quarter.

The long-run direction has been consistently rising across the 47 years of available data.

Averages by decade

DecadeAverage LowestHighest Years
1970s 4.04 million 3.77 million 4.31 million 2
1980s 4.28 million 3.89 million 4.53 million 10
1990s 5.11 million 4.65 million 6.13 million 10
2000s 6.40 million 5.96 million 6.72 million 10
2010s 7.04 million 6.78 million 7.52 million 10
2020s 8.15 million 7.66 million 8.61 million 5
